using System;
using System.Globalization;
using osu.Framework.Allocation;
using osu.Framework.Configuration;
using osu.Framework.Graphics;
using osu.Framework.Graphics.Containers;
using osu.Framework.Graphics.Effects;
using osu.Framework.Graphics.Shapes;
using osu.Framework.Graphics.Transforms;
using osu.Framework.Graphics.UserInterface;
using osu.Framework.Input.Bindings;
using osu.Framework.MathUtils;
using osu.Game.Graphics;
using osu.Game.Graphics.Sprites;
using osu.Game.Input.Bindings;
using OpenTK;
using OpenTK.Graphics;
namespace osu.Game.Overlays.Volume
{
public class VolumeMeter : Container, IKeyBindingHandler<GlobalAction>
{
private CircularProgress volumeCircle;
public BindableDouble Bindable { get; } = new BindableDouble();
private readonly float circleSize;
private readonly Color4 meterColour;
private readonly string name;
public VolumeMeter(string name, float circleSize, Color4 meterColour)
{
this.circleSize = circleSize;
this.meterColour = meterColour;
this.name = name;
AutoSizeAxes = Axes.Both;
}
[BackgroundDependencyLoader]
private void load(OsuColour colours)
{
Add(new Container
{
Size = new Vector2(120, 20),
CornerRadius = 10,
Masking = true,
Margin = new MarginPadding { Left = circleSize + 10 },
Origin = Anchor.CentreLeft,
Anchor = Anchor.CentreLeft,
Children = new Drawable[]
{
new Box
{
RelativeSizeAxes = Axes.Both,
Colour = colours.Gray1,
Alpha = 0.9f,
},
new OsuSpriteText
{
Anchor = Anchor.Centre,
Origin = Anchor.Centre,
Font = "Exo2.0-Bold",
Text = name
}
}
});
OsuSpriteText text, maxText;
CircularProgress bgProgress;
BufferedContainer maxGlow;
Add(new CircularContainer
{
Masking = true,
Size = new Vector2(circleSize),
Children = new Drawable[]
{
new Box
{
RelativeSizeAxes = Axes.Both,
Colour = colours.Gray1,
Alpha = 0.9f,
},
bgProgress = new CircularProgress
{
RelativeSizeAxes = Axes.Both,
InnerRadius = 0.05f,
Rotation = 180,
Anchor = Anchor.Centre,
Origin = Anchor.Centre,
Colour = colours.Gray2,
Size = new Vector2(0.8f)
},
(volumeCircle = new CircularProgress
{
RelativeSizeAxes = Axes.Both,
InnerRadius = 0.05f,
Rotation = 180,
Anchor = Anchor.Centre,
Origin = Anchor.Centre,
Size = new Vector2(0.8f)
}).WithEffect(new GlowEffect
{
Colour = meterColour,
Strength = 2
}),
maxGlow = new OsuSpriteText
{
Anchor = Anchor.Centre,
Origin = Anchor.Centre,
Font = "Venera",
Text = "MAX",
TextSize = 0.16f * circleSize
}.WithEffect(new GlowEffect
{
Colour = meterColour,
PadExtent = true,
Strength = 2,
}),
text = new OsuSpriteText
{
Anchor = Anchor.Centre,
Origin = Anchor.Centre,
Font = "Venera",
TextSize = 0.16f * circleSize
}
}
});
Bindable.ValueChanged += newVolume => this.TransformTo("circleBindable", newVolume * 0.75, 250, Easing.OutQuint);
volumeCircle.Current.ValueChanged += newVolume => //by using this event we sync the meter with the text. newValue has to be divided by 0.75 to give the actual percentage
{
if (Precision.DefinitelyBigger(newVolume, 0.74))
{
text.Alpha = 0;
maxGlow.Alpha = 1; //show "MAX"
}
else
{
text.Text = Math.Round(newVolume / 0.0075).ToString(CultureInfo.CurrentCulture);
text.Alpha = 1;
maxGlow.Alpha = 0;
}
};
bgProgress.Current.Value = 0.75f;
}
/// <summary>
/// This is needed because <see cref="TransformCustom{TValue,T}"/> doesn't support <see cref="Bindable{T}"/>
/// </summary>
private double circleBindable
{
get => volumeCircle.Current;
set => volumeCircle.Current.Value = value;
}
public double Volume
{
get => Bindable;
private set => Bindable.Value = value;
}
public void Increase()
{
Volume += 0.05f;
}
public void Decrease()
{
Volume -= 0.05f;
}
public bool OnPressed(GlobalAction action)
{
if (!IsHovered) return false;
switch (action)
{
case GlobalAction.DecreaseVolume:
Decrease();
return true;
case GlobalAction.IncreaseVolume:
Increase();
return true;
}
return false;
}
public bool OnReleased(GlobalAction action) => false;
}
}
